How an Ultrasonic Humidifier Works
An ultrasonic humidifier creates mist by vibrating a small ceramic disc called a transducer at extremely high frequency. The transducer sits at the bottom of the water reservoir and shakes water at roughly 1.6 million times per second. This breaks the water into tiny droplets that a small fan pushes into your room.
Unlike warm mist units, there is no heating element. That means the process is quiet and energy efficient. It also means the transducer is the single most important part of the system, and when it gets blocked the entire unit fails.
The piezoelectric diaphragm needs direct contact with clean water to vibrate properly. Any film, scale, or debris stops the vibration and shuts down mist production.
Think of it like a speaker cone. If something is pressing against it, the sound dies. The same principle applies here.
Water enters the base from the tank through a small valve. The valve opens when the tank is seated on the base. If the valve is stuck or the tank is crooked, no water reaches the plate.
The unit runs, but nothing happens because the transducer is literally sitting in air. Understanding this flow helps you see why most fixes are so simple.
Ultrasonic Humidifier Not Working? Check These Symptoms First
Before you start taking anything apart, match your symptom to the likely cause. This saves time and prevents unnecessary cleaning. Here are the most common failure patterns we see.
No Power or Lights
If the unit shows no lights and makes no noise when you press the power button, the problem is almost always electrical. Check that the power cord is firmly connected and the outlet works by plugging in another device. Try a different outlet in a different room to rule out a tripped breaker.
Some models have a small fuse inside the base that can blow during power surges. If your unit uses a wall adapter, test the adapter with a voltmeter or swap it with a known working adapter of the same voltage.
We have seen brand new units that appeared dead simply because the adapter was not fully inserted. Look at the power indicator. A dim or flickering light can mean the adapter is failing but not completely dead.
This is a common sign of an aging power supply. Replacing the adapter often costs less than ten dollars and restores the unit immediately.
Power On But No Mist
When the lights come on and the fan runs but you see no mist, the ultrasonic plate is either blocked or broken. Mineral buildup is the culprit in about eight out of ten cases. The unit thinks it is working, but the water is not atomizing.
We have tested this scenario repeatedly. A unit that was misting fine yesterday and suddenly stopped almost always has a white crust on the transducer.
The fix is cleaning, not replacing. We have restored units that sat unused for months after a single vinegar soak.
Listen closely when you power the unit on. You should hear a very faint hum or buzz from the base. That sound is the transducer vibrating.
If you hear nothing at all, the transducer circuit may have failed. If you hear the hum but see no mist, the plate is almost certainly dirty.
Red Light Stays On
A solid or flashing red light usually means the water level sensor thinks the tank is empty. Even if you see water in the tank, the sensor might not detect it. Check that the tank is seated correctly and that the float sensor moves freely.
Some humidifiers use a red light to indicate the water is low. Others use it to warn of dirty water or a blocked diaphragm. Check your manual to confirm what your model’s light means.
On some Levoit models, a red light means the tank is not aligned. On Honeywell units, it often means the water is low.
Tap the base gently with your finger. Sometimes the float sensor is stuck by a tiny air bubble or mineral deposit. A light tap can free it.
If the light changes to blue or green, you have found the problem.
Making Noise But No Mist
If your humidifier is making noise but not producing mist, the fan is working but the transducer is not. The noise you hear is the motor running without the high-frequency vibration that creates mist. This almost always points to a blocked or failed transducer.
Check the plate first. If it is clean and the noise continues without mist, the ceramic disc may have cracked. A cracked disc cannot generate the frequency needed to break water into droplets. The fan spins, the motor hums, but no mist forms.
How to Fix an Ultrasonic Humidifier Not Producing Mist
Follow these steps in order. Each one takes only a few minutes. Do not skip ahead, because the easiest fix is usually the right one.
We have arranged these from the simplest check to the most involved cleaning.
Step 1: Test the Power Supply and Outlet
Unplug the humidifier and wait thirty seconds. Plug it into a different outlet that you know works. If the unit still shows no signs of life, inspect the power cord for damage.
Look for fraying, kinks, or chew marks if you have pets. Many units use a detachable DC adapter. If the adapter is loose, the unit will not power on.
Press the connector firmly into the base and listen for the power beep or light. If the adapter wobbles, the internal socket may be cracked. That requires professional repair.
Check your circuit breaker. Humidifiers draw very little power, but a tripped breaker can still cut them off. If the outlet is controlled by a wall switch, make sure the switch is on.
We have heard from readers who spent hours troubleshooting a unit that was simply on a switched outlet.
Step 2: Clean the Ultrasonic Transducer and Diaphragm
Remove the water tank and look at the base where the tank sits. You will see a small round or square metal plate. This is the transducer.
If it is white, crusty, or discolored, it needs cleaning. Even a thin film can stop the vibration completely.
Mix equal parts white vinegar and water. Dampen a soft cloth or cotton swab with the mixture and wipe the plate gently. Do not press hard.
The ceramic surface is fragile. Let the vinegar sit for five minutes if the buildup is thick. For severe buildup, use a soft toothbrush and scrub in small circles.
After cleaning, rinse the base with clean water. Dry it thoroughly with a cloth. We have restored dozens of units that were completely silent just by removing this mineral film.
One user told us their humidifier worked like new after a single cleaning. Another reader soaked the plate overnight and saw a dramatic improvement the next morning.
If vinegar does not remove the buildup, try a mixture of one tablespoon citric acid in one cup of warm water. Citric acid dissolves calcium faster than vinegar and leaves less odor.
You can find citric acid powder online or in the canning section of most grocery stores.
Step 3: Check the Water Tank Placement and Seal
Ultrasonic humidifiers need a specific alignment between the tank and the base to let water flow onto the transducer. If the tank is twisted even slightly, water may not reach the plate.
Remove the tank and set it back down, making sure it sits flat and level. Check the rubber gasket or seal on the tank bottom.
A dry or cracked gasket can let air in and prevent water from draining properly. Some tanks have a small valve that only opens when the tank is on the base. Make sure this valve moves freely.
Press it with your finger. It should spring back. After cleaning, it is very common to reassemble the tank incorrectly.
The cap may seem tight, but if the gasket is twisted, air leaks in and water stops flowing. Take the cap off and reseat the gasket carefully.
This alone has fixed countless units that stopped working after cleaning.
Step 4: Inspect the Fan and Mist Outlet
If the transducer is clean and the tank is seated correctly, but you still see no mist, the fan may be stuck. Look into the mist outlet or nozzle.
Dust and hair can clog the small fan blades. Use a can of compressed air or a soft brush to clear the outlet. Turn the unit on and hold your hand near the outlet.
You should feel a gentle breeze. If you feel air but still see no mist, the transducer has likely failed and needs replacement. If you feel no air at all, the fan motor is the problem.
A dead fan motor is harder to fix than a dirty plate, but replacement fans are available for many popular models. Check that the mist nozzle is not aimed at a wall or curtain.
In high humidity, the mist can condense before it leaves the unit. This makes it look like the humidifier is not working when it actually is. Move the unit to an open area and test again.
How to Tell If the Transducer Is Broken vs Just Dirty
A dirty transducer is the most common problem. A broken transducer is rare, but it does happen. Here is how to tell the difference.
After cleaning the plate with vinegar and rinsing thoroughly, fill the base and power the unit on. If you hear the faint hum but still see zero mist after five minutes, the ceramic disc underneath the plate may be cracked.
A cracked transducer cannot vibrate at the right frequency. You will need a replacement part from the manufacturer or a generic transducer kit from an electronics supplier.
If you hear no hum at all, the circuit board that drives the transducer may be damaged. This often happens after running the unit dry or after a power surge.
In most cases, a dead circuit board means it is time to replace the unit. Repairing the board is rarely cost-effective for a home appliance.
Common Mistakes That Stop Your Humidifier From Working
Many failures are not caused by defects. They are caused by simple user errors that are easy to avoid once you know what they are.
Using Tap Water Instead of Distilled Water
Tap water contains calcium and magnesium that deposit onto the transducer. The EPA notes that these minerals not only reduce performance but also create white dust on your furniture. We always recommend distilled or demineralized water for ultrasonic units.
Using distilled water can double the time between cleanings. It also keeps the mist outlet clear. If you must use tap water, clean the transducer at least once a week.
In areas with very hard water, you may need to clean it every three to four days to maintain full output. Some users add water softening tablets or essential oils directly to the tank.
Essential oils can coat the transducer and break down the plastic. Water softening salt can corrode the metal contacts. Stick to plain distilled water for the best results.
Running the Unit Dry
Most ultrasonic humidifiers have an auto shut-off that triggers when the tank empties. Running the unit dry for extended periods can still damage the transducer. The ceramic plate heats up without water to absorb the vibration.
That heat can warp the diaphragm or crack the ceramic. One Reddit user reported their Honeywell HUL570 stopped producing mist after running dry overnight. This is a common pattern.
If you suspect heat damage, let the unit cool for an hour and then try cleaning the plate. If it still does not work, the transducer may need replacement. Always refill the tank before it runs completely empty.
Overfilling or Incorrect Assembly After Cleaning
After cleaning, it is easy to put the tank back on the base incorrectly. The tank may seem to fit, but if the valve is not aligned, water will not flow.
Always check for the small click or drop in water level that indicates the tank is feeding the base. Overfilling can also trigger the overflow sensor on some models.
Fill only to the max line indicated on the tank. More water does not mean more mist. It just means more problems.
We have seen units leak because the tank was filled past the seal line.
Brand-Specific Troubleshooting Tips
While the core mechanics are similar, each brand has quirks. Here are the most common issues we see by manufacturer. These tips come from our own testing and from real user reports on forums.
Levoit Humidifier Not Working
Levoit units often show a red light when the water tank is not fully seated. The tank has a small magnetic sensor that must align with the base. Twist the tank slightly while pressing down until you hear a soft click.
If the red light persists, clean the sensor area with a dry cloth. Some Levoit models also have a separate aroma pad tray. If this tray is missing or misaligned, the unit may refuse to start.
Double-check that all accessories are in place. The Classic 100 and Dual 200S models are particularly sensitive to tray alignment.
Levoit units with built-in humidity sensors may shut off if the room is already at the target level. If the unit powers on but stops after a few minutes, raise the humidity target or move the unit to a drier part of the room.
Honeywell Ultrasonic Humidifier Not Working
Honeywell ultrasonic humidifiers are prone to transducer scaling if you use hard tap water. The HUL570 in particular has a small transducer that clogs quickly. Clean the plate with vinegar every five to seven days of use.
We have found that the HUL570 stops misting almost exactly one week after cleaning when using hard water. These units also have a resettable thermal fuse. If the unit stops after running dry, unplug it and let it sit for thirty minutes.
This gives the thermal fuse time to reset. If it still does not power on, the fuse may have blown and needs professional repair. Do not attempt to bypass the fuse. It is a safety feature.
Homedics Humidifier Not Working
Homedics units frequently have float sensor issues. The small float inside the base can stick if mineral deposits build up. Remove the base cover and gently shake the float to confirm it moves up and down.
Soak the base in vinegar to dissolve any deposits around the float chamber. Many Homedics models also have a demineralization cartridge. If this cartridge is expired, the unit may produce less mist or stop entirely.
Replace the cartridge every thirty to forty fillings. The cartridge is easy to forget, but it is critical for hard water areas.
Mini and Travel Humidifier Specific Issues
Mini ultrasonic humidifiers are popular for desks and travel, but they fail differently than large units. Their transducers are smaller and clog faster. A mini unit can stop misting after just two or three days of tap water use.
USB-powered mini humidifiers sometimes draw more power than the port provides. If your mini unit works on one laptop but not another, the USB port may not supply enough current. Try a wall adapter rated for at least one amp.
The weak power supply will run the light but not the transducer. Travel humidifiers often use a water bottle instead of a tank. If the bottle is too soft or too hard, the seal can leak or fail.
Use a standard disposable water bottle with a standard neck size. Fancy bottles with wide mouths or sports caps rarely seal correctly.
When to Replace Instead of Repair
Sometimes fixing your ultrasonic humidifier not working is not worth the effort. If the unit is under warranty, contact the manufacturer first. Most brands offer a one-year warranty that covers transducer failure.
Keep your receipt and serial number handy. If the unit is more than three years old and the transducer has failed, replacement parts often cost nearly as much as a new unit.
We also recommend replacing any humidifier that has cracked plastic in the water reservoir. Bacteria can hide in cracks and are nearly impossible to remove.
Finally, if you have tried every step in this guide and the unit still does not mist, the circuit board may be damaged. That repair requires specialized tools and is rarely practical for home users.

Maintenance Tips to Keep Your Humidifier Running in 2026
Prevention is the best fix. A ten-minute cleaning routine once a week keeps most ultrasonic humidifiers working for years. Empty the tank daily, rinse the base, and wipe the transducer with a vinegar-dampened cloth.
Always use distilled water if your budget allows. The cost is small compared to the frustration of a broken unit. It also reduces white dust and improves indoor air quality.

Never pack it away with water in the tank. Standing water breeds mold and bacteria that can permanently damage the diaphragm and fan.
We recommend running the unit for five minutes with no water to dry the transducer before storage. Replace filters and cartridges on the schedule the manufacturer recommends.
Even if the unit seems to work fine, a clogged filter can strain the fan and reduce mist output. A ten-dollar cartridge is cheaper than a new humidifier.
Check the mist nozzle monthly for dust buildup. A blocked nozzle reduces airflow and can make the unit work harder than necessary. Simple preventive care keeps the motor and fan running quietly for years.
Frequently Asked Questions
Why is my humidifier not blowing out mist?
The most common reason is mineral buildup on the ultrasonic transducer. Clean the metal plate at the base with white vinegar and water. Also check that the tank is seated correctly and the unit has power.
Why is there no mist coming out of my ultrasonic humidifier?
No mist usually means the vibrating diaphragm is blocked or the water is not reaching the plate. Remove the tank, clean the transducer with vinegar, and check the water valve. If the fan runs but no mist appears, the transducer may need replacement.
Why is my humidifier ultrasonic plate not working?
The ultrasonic plate fails when it is coated with mineral scale or has been damaged by running dry. Soak the plate in white vinegar for ten minutes and gently wipe it clean. If it still does not vibrate after cleaning, the ceramic disc is likely cracked and needs replacement.
What is the problem with ultrasonic humidifiers?
The main problem is mineral buildup from tap water. The fine mist leaves calcium deposits on the transducer, which blocks vibration. Using distilled water and cleaning weekly prevents this. Some users also report white dust from minerals in the water.
